Google Chrome Blocks 7 Billion Abusive Notifications a Day With Multi-Layered Defenses

Brief

Google Chrome has reduced abusive notifications on Android by more than 7 billion per day during the first quarter of 2026, according to a new technical overview from Chrome Security, Safe Browsing , and Firebase Cloud Messaging (FCM).

The milestone reflects a multi-year effort to curb a web feature frequently exploited by scammers, malware distributors, and fraud operators.

While browser notifications can provide legitimate real-time updates from websites, threat actors have increasingly weaponized them to deliver deceptive alerts, fake security warnings, credential-harvesting lures, and fraudulent payment prompts.
